Seaweed for juvenile grass carp shows potential for Gran Canaria’s blue economy

Macroalgal wracks have potential as a feed additive in juvenile grass carp (Ctenopharyngodon idella) diets, creating an economic value to the marine plants.  A study in Spain by Galindo et al. cited that seven per cent of the macroalgae may be included in the diet “without detrimental effect on C. idella survival, growth, proximate composition, FA (fatty acids) or LC (lipid classes) profile, oxidative status, and digestive capacity.”


FAI launches tilapia welfare app and online training

Working with scientists and farmers in Brazil, Thailand and China, FAI Farms has developed a free to use tilapia welfare app that uses scientifically validated welfare indicators for fish health, behaviour and nutrition, as well as environmental conditions.


Scottish semi-closed farm pioneers to fight planning rejection

The team behind the proposed creation of Scotland’s first semi-closed salmon production unit is to fight the rejection of the venture by local authority planners, claiming that a blocking decision taken last autumn was “fundamentally flawed.”
